What Hard Water Does to Your Home
Let’s paint the picture. Hard water is simply water that’s loaded with minerals like calcium and magnesium. On paper, that doesn’t sound too bad—after all, minerals are natural. But when that mineral-rich water runs through your home every single day, the results aren’t exactly kind. Think soap scum building up faster than you can scrub it off, water heaters working overtime just to keep up, and that frustrating cycle of washing dishes only to find them spotty again.
Over time, hard water doesn’t just leave marks; it slowly wears down the efficiency of your appliances and plumbing. That “extra rinse” button on your washing machine? Yeah, it’s probably working harder because of hard water. And that can mean higher bills, shorter appliance lifespans, and an overall sense that your house is always one step behind.

Things Homeowners Should Ask Before Installing
If you’re considering a water softener, it’s worth going in with a few smart questions. Start with capacity—how much water does your household actually use, and is the system sized for that? Ask about salt vs. salt-free options, and whether the provider offers environmentally friendly alternatives. Make sure you know the maintenance schedule and what kind of warranty you’re getting.
And don’t be afraid to ask for real numbers. How much can you expect to save on energy bills? What’s the average lifespan of the system? A good provider won’t shy away from those conversations—they’ll welcome them.
Busting a Few Myths
Before wrapping this up, let’s clear the air on a couple of common misconceptions. First, softened water doesn’t taste “slimy.” That’s just one of those myths that sticks around from outdated systems. Modern softeners are designed to keep the water crisp and fresh. Second, water softeners don’t make your water unsafe to drink. In fact, by reducing scale buildup, they can actually help keep your pipes cleaner.
And for those who worry about the environment, there are plenty of systems today that use less salt and less water during regeneration, making them far more eco-conscious than people expect.
